Those floods were caused by the remnants of hurricane Ida that came up from
the Carribean, across the Gulf of Mexico into Mississippi/Alabama, then
across N. Florida and Georgia into the Atlantic, up the E coast as a
Nor'easter across the N Atlantic and into England.  Where will it go next
